Minimizing overgrown plants is a critical element of landscape management, assisting to bring back order, enhance aesthetics,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ict airflow, reduce sunshine penetration, and develop chances for pests and illness. Pruning and thinning are the primary methods for managing thick or unruly plant life, allowing plants to flourish while maintaining a regulated appearance. The procedure includes sel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ly thinking about the natural development routine of each species. Timing is necessary; some plants respond best to pruning during dormancy, while blooming varieties might require post-bloom trimming to maintain blooms. Proper method ensures cuts are tidy and located to encourage healthy brand-new growth. In addition to boosting plant health, decreasing overgrowth enhances ease of access and visibility in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outdoor living spaces end up being more secure and more welcoming. Long-lasting maintenance plans avoid future overgrowth, making sure a balanced and unified landscape.
